What are the most common Chevrolet repair issues you see for vehicles driven in the Grover, PA area?

Due to our rural roads and winter weather, we frequently address suspension components, brake wear, and 4WD system maintenance on Chevrolet trucks and SUVs. For models like the Equinox and Malibu, issues with the thermostat and cooling systems are also common, which can be exacerbated by temperature fluctuations.

When should I seek immediate service for my Chevrolet's check engine light around Grover?

Seek immediate service if the light is flashing, or if you notice a loss of power, strange noises, or overheating, especially when navigating our hilly terrain. A solid light still warrants a prompt diagnostic check at a local shop to prevent a minor issue from becoming a major, costly repair.

What local driving conditions in Grover should influence my Chevrolet's maintenance schedule?

The gravel/dirt roads and significant winter salt use mean you should have suspension and undercarriage inspections more frequently, and adhere strictly to oil change intervals. For trucks used for hauling or farming, more frequent transmission and brake service is recommended due to the increased strain.
